监控平台如何实现自动化运维?
在当今信息化时代,监控平台作为企业信息化建设的重要组成部分,对于确保企业信息系统稳定运行具有重要意义。然而,随着企业业务规模的不断扩大,监控平台的数据量、任务量也随之增加,如何实现监控平台的自动化运维成为企业面临的一大挑战。本文将深入探讨监控平台如何实现自动化运维,为读者提供有益的参考。
一、监控平台自动化运维的意义
提高运维效率:通过自动化运维,可以降低运维人员的工作强度,减少人工干预,提高运维效率。
降低运维成本:自动化运维可以减少人力成本,降低运维过程中的风险,提高运维效果。
提高系统稳定性:自动化运维可以及时发现并处理系统故障,确保系统稳定运行。
提升运维质量:自动化运维可以规范运维流程,提高运维质量,降低人为错误。
二、监控平台自动化运维的关键技术
监控自动化工具:利用监控自动化工具,可以实现对监控数据的自动采集、处理和分析。
事件驱动机制:通过事件驱动机制,可以实现监控平台的智能化,自动响应系统异常。
工作流引擎:工作流引擎可以将监控任务、告警处理、故障恢复等环节串联起来,实现自动化运维。
云计算技术:云计算技术可以实现监控平台的弹性扩展,提高运维效率。
大数据分析:通过对监控数据的分析,可以预测系统故障,实现预防性运维。
三、监控平台自动化运维的具体实施
- 监控数据采集与处理
(1)使用自动化工具:利用如Zabbix、Nagios等自动化监控工具,实现对服务器、网络、数据库等关键指标的自动采集。
(2)数据预处理:对采集到的数据进行预处理,包括数据清洗、去重、格式转换等。
- 事件驱动与告警处理
(1)设置阈值:根据业务需求,设置监控指标的阈值,实现实时告警。
(2)事件响应:当监控指标超过阈值时,系统自动触发事件响应,如发送邮件、短信、微信等通知。
- 工作流引擎与故障恢复
(1)工作流设计:根据业务需求,设计监控任务、告警处理、故障恢复等工作流。
(2)工作流执行:系统自动执行工作流,实现自动化运维。
- 云计算与弹性扩展
(1)云平台选择:选择合适的云平台,如阿里云、腾讯云等,实现监控平台的弹性扩展。
(2)资源分配:根据业务需求,合理分配云资源,提高运维效率。
- 大数据分析与预测性运维
(1)数据挖掘:利用大数据技术,对监控数据进行挖掘,找出潜在故障。
(2)预测性运维:根据数据分析结果,提前预测系统故障,实现预防性运维。
四、案例分析
以某企业监控平台为例,该企业采用以下自动化运维措施:
使用Zabbix作为监控自动化工具,实现对服务器、网络、数据库等关键指标的自动采集。
设置阈值,当监控指标超过阈值时,自动触发事件响应,如发送邮件、短信等通知。
设计工作流,将监控任务、告警处理、故障恢复等环节串联起来,实现自动化运维。
选择阿里云作为云平台,实现监控平台的弹性扩展。
利用大数据技术,对监控数据进行挖掘,找出潜在故障,实现预测性运维。
通过实施以上自动化运维措施,该企业显著提高了运维效率,降低了运维成本,确保了系统稳定运行。
总之,监控平台自动化运维是企业信息化建设的重要环节。通过运用先进的技术手段,可以实现监控平台的自动化运维,提高运维效率,降低运维成本,确保系统稳定运行。企业应根据自身业务需求,选择合适的自动化运维方案,以实现信息化建设的持续发展。
猜你喜欢:OpenTelemetry